Output 128b3d1cddc5994f0edb577d88fab948619f87a23bf162bedfbf16f2bff305f9:23

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4efc630fd5ca79aa35f7ee2803a8839e4189259a OP_EQUAL
address
38teyfENKVKtRketDTqGxQU7GExFvSFqRC
transaction
128b3d1cddc5994f0edb577d88fab948619f87a23bf162bedfbf16f2bff305f9
spent
true